In general, the Law of Bases and Starting Points for the Freedom of Argentines was approved on Wednesday around midnight in the Senate. Same result for the Law on Palliative and Relevant Fiscal Measures, but first thing this Thursday morning.

In the first case, there was a tie at 36, so the Vice President of the Nation and President of the Senate, Victoria Villarruel, broke the tie in favor of the ruling party.

The Upper House during the debate of the mega project that Milei sent to Congress last December. Credit: Senate Communication

Among the 72 legislators, three belong to the province of Santa Fe: Eduardo Galaretto from the Unión Cívica Radical bloc, Carolina Losada from the Unión Cívica Radical bloc and Marcelo Lewandowski from the National and Popular Front bloc.

How Santa Fe residents voted for the Bases Law

Regarding the fiscal package, it was approved in general with a total of 37, to then give rise to the vote in particular.

Carolina Losada stated during the debate: “The Argentine people are making an enormous, brutal effort. I see people from middle and lower social classes who want something to finally change in this country. Because of that hope of all those people, in which I I include, I am going to vote positively for this law.

For his part, Galaretto expressed: “We have been a responsible opposition in our province and today we are a provincial government. We want to be responsible opponents of the Nation and we will see what the future holds for us. No impeding machine, no unnecessary delays, no blank checks.” .

Lewandoski reflected: “It is true that we owe ourselves State policies that last over time, that have predictability for those who want to come to invest and for those of us who live in the country, but the Base Law and the DNU ignore the basic functions of the State.”

How Santa Fe residents voted for the fiscal package

The trend continued and there were no surprises in the fifth title, in which the Senate rejected the return of Ganancias with votes in favor of Galaretto and Losada and the rejection of Lewandoski.

In title one of the fiscal package, the Regime for Regularization of Tax, Customs and Social Security Obligations, is the only one where the people of Santa Fe agreed amidst the unanimous approval of the Senate.
